1.1.4 During the public hearing, UJVNL was directed to submit the details of expenses incurred towards canal based solar power plants. UJVNL Ltd. submitted the expected employee expenses of Rs. 6.75 Lakh for FY 2023-24 towards solar power plants and also submitted the details of expenditure incurred towards consultancy for preparation of DPR and other documents amounting to Rs. 82.88 Lakh. UJVNL Ltd. also submitted the details of O&M expenses incurred for the last five years.
1.1.5 The Commission gone through the given data and observed that total expenses incurred for preparation of DPR and other administration works are amounting to Rs. 89.63 Lakh and considering the total installed capacity of solar power plants of 26.264 MW, per MW expenses incurred by UJVNL Ltd. works out to Rs. 3.42 Lakh/MW which has an impact of approximate only approximately 2% on the tariff. However, considering the fact that with the increase of number of solar power plants, more O&M expenses will be required for paperwork and other official procedures. Further, there shall be no motive for engaging in such activities for installation of Solar power plants if the entire tariff discovered through bidding is transfer to the L-1 bidder. Accordingly, a reasonable return should be there to motivate eligible government organisation to execute such activities to ensure smooth installation and operations of solar power plant. Therefore, the Commission has decided to fix 8% additional tariff over and above tariff quoted by L-1 bidder. However, the same shall be applicable only for implementation of canal bank and canal top solar power plants implemented by eligible Government organisations.

The Commission is of the view that the Parallel operation is an activity where one electrical system operates with the connectivity to another system in similar operating conditions. The captive power plants opt for parallel operations to seek safety, security and reliability of operation with the support of a much larger and stable system as afforded by the grid. Captive power plants, which are designed to meet the electricity needs of a specific entity or facility, often require access to the grid for synchronization and backup power supply. Parallel Operation Charges are imposed to cover the costs associated with granting grid access and providing necessary technical support for parallel operation, including system stability, voltage regulation, and frequency control for grid access and support. Further, Captive power plants, when operated in parallel with the grid, become part of the interconnected power system. Grid operators have to ensure the stability, reliability, and overall performance of the grid even when additional power sources are connected. Parallel Operation Charges contribute to the funds needed to manage the integration of captive power plants into the grid and ensure the system remains balanced and secure.

1.15.1 Him Urja Pvt. Ltd. submitted that draft Regulation specifies that provisional tariff may be determined based on the actual expenditure incurred upto the date of making the application. The financial institutions are putting up conditions that the provisional tariff should be known to them before more than certain percentage of loan is disbursed. The developer has to move the application to the Commission after getting the expenditure audited when the actual expenditure incurred may be about 30% of the project cost.
Therefore, it is requested that the Commission may determine provisional tariff based on the Capital cost in DPR, Cost taken by financial institution, cost approved by concerned government, cost of other projects being approved by the Commission and all other material facts necessary for determination of the provisional tariff. The Provisional tariff may be determined by the Commission any time after financial closure of the project. This will facilitate the SHPs in getting finances of the project.
1.15.2 The Commission agrees that the financial institutions sanction the loan amount based on the expected revenue from the project. Therefore, the Commission allows the developers to approach the Commission for determination of provisional tariff based on the actual expenditure incurred upto the date of making an application. Initially, the project developers infuse equity and based on the same, financial institutions disburse
proportionate loan amount. However, it is worth mentioning that the Commission provides two options to the developers, either to approach the Commission based on the actual expenditure for determination of provisional tariff or the developer can accept generic tariff as provisional tariff till the fixation of final tariff. Accordingly, the developer may accept generic tariff, if the actual expenditure incurred is not sufficient to get a suitable provisional tariff. Accordingly, the request of the stakeholder w.r.t determination of the provisional tariff based on the Capital cost in DPR, Cost taken by financial institution, cost approved by concerned government, cost of other projects being approved by the Commission is not proper. The Electricity Act, 2003 provides for determination of cost-plus tariff and cost must be actually incurred costs and not projected costs. Hence, the request of the stakeholder in this regard is rejected.

1.17.10 Many of the stakeholders raised the issue that cost of transmission line has increased.
The Commission had first time provided the RE generators to construct their own evacuation infrastructure at a cost of 5 paisa/kWh in 2010. The cost of material has increased. Supply Code Regulations specify a cost of Rs. 1.25 Crore for a 10 km 33 kV line as against Rs. 85 Lakh specified in draft Regulations. The Commission agrees with the comments of the Stakeholders and decides to revise the cost of evacuation infrastructure. The Commission has considered the base cost of the transmission line as specified under State Grid Code, 2020 which is as follows:
| (i) Upto 3MW, 11 kV S/C | - Rs. 8.00 Lakh/km |
| (ii) Above 3MW and upto 13 MW, 33 kV S/C | - Rs. 12.50 Lakh/km |
| (iii) Above 13 MW and upto 25 MW, 33 kV 2 x S/C or DC | - Rs. 25.00 Lakh/km |
Accordingly, if a generating station opts to construct the evacuation infrastructure from point of inter-connection to the nearest sub-station of transmission or distribution licensee to which the generating station is connected, it shall be allowed a normative levelised tariff specified in the Regulations over and above the generic tariff determined at the point of inter-connection. However, in case of a solar generating company a normative levelised tariff specified in the Regulations over and above the generic tariff determined at the point of inter-connection shall be allowed.
1.17.11 During the proceedings in the matter, it was brought to the notice of the Commission that in several cases, UPCL is paying 5 paisa/kWh or 12 Paisa/kWh as the case may be even where transmission line has not been constructed by generator till the sub-station of UPCL. In the matter, the Commission is of the view that per unit rate may be recovered based on proportionate line constructed by the developer.

It can be observed from the above table, that the neighbouring State, i.e. Himachal Pradesh has specified the benchmark capital cost lower than the capital cost proposed by this Commission. Further, HPERC has considered the same capital cost as specified by CERC irrespective of installation capacity. Assam ERC has specified benchmark capital cost as specified by Central Commission vide its repealed RE Regulations, 2017. Further, as per Section 61 of the Act, the State Commissions shall be guided by the principles and methodology specified by the Central Commission for tariff determination. Accordingly, the Commission does not find it prudent to change the capital Costs in the final Regulation.
1.24.8 During the finalisation of RE Regulations, 2018, with regard to revision of O&M expenses, most of the SHP developers requested the Commission for revision of the O&M expenses and allow O&M expenses equivalent to the Large Hydro Projects. Accordingly, to bring parity between the O&M expenses for LHP and SHP, the Commission had revised the normative O&M expenses. However, now some of the SHP developers have claimed that the O&M expenses of SHPs are more than Large Hydro Plants. However, supporting documents have not been submitted by the stakeholders to validate their claim. Accordingly, the Commission does not find it prudent to review the O&M expenses.
1.24.9 Further, with regard to the comment of M/s Him Urja Associate regarding equal CUF of 40% for generators opting for generic tariff and generator opting for project specific tariff, since the developers have an option to get their tariff determined based on the actual capital cost, accordingly, their CUF should also be considered to be equal to that provided in the DPR as that would be the close to the actual CUF that can be attained by the project based on the past studies. This dispensation has been allowed since RE Regulations 2010, based on Hon'ble ATE's Judgment dated 18.09.2009 in Techman Infra Ltd. vs. HPERC and others. Hence, no change is warranted in this regard.

From the above table, it is explicitly clear that with the passage of time, cost of solar technology is declining. There is a decline of 31.50% in the cost of modules in the last five years. Further, in the month of May 2023, the average of module cost was USD 0.193/Wp and now which has further reduced to USD 0.166/Wp.
The Commission in its draft Regulations had considered the cost of Solar PV Module as Rs. 360.47 Lakh/MW considering the exchange rate of Rs. 82.23/USD based on then available exchange rate for the last six months, considering the module cost of 0.193 USD/Wp, degradation of 0.50% and 20% additional cost for duties and other expenses. As per the website of www.pvinsights.com which provides the spot price of modules in international market, the latest Solar PV Module Weekly support Price, as
accessed on 02.08.2023, is as under:-
| Item | Average (USD/Wp) |
|---|---|
| Poly Module | 0.143 |
| Mono PERC Module in China | 0.147 |
| Thin Film Solar Module | 0.209 |
The average of these works out to 0.166 USD/Wp against 0.193 USD/Wp considered in Draft Regulations. Further, average exchange rate for the last six months works out to Rs. 82.28/USD against Rs. 82.23/USD considered exchange rate of last six months. Accordingly, based on the above discussion and considering the degradation of 0.50%, the module cost works out to Rs. 136.69 Lakh/MW. The Government of India has announced levy of import duty, w.r.f. 01.04.2022, on the import of Solar PV cells and Solar PV modules @ 25% and 40% respectively. Moreover, the GST rate for the goods component has also been increased from 5% to 12%. Apart from the above, the Government of India has provided for the production linked incentive of Rs. 4500 Crore, in addition to the production linked incentive of Rs. 19500 Crore provided for the budget proposed for FY 2022-23 which is applicable for current year also. All the factors would have overlapping and diverse effects and may also increase the competitiveness. Such factors shall impact the market rates at which the Solar PV cells and Solar PV modules shall be available from various sources. Moreover, the difference in the cost of Solar PV cells and module as well as taxes thereon, if availed optimally, can also facilitate marginal reduction in the over-all cost of the panels.
After taking all related factors into account and comments of various stakeholders regarding bank charges for conversion of INR to USD, taxes & duties and overheads, the Commission decides to escalate the module cost by 28%. Accordingly, the module cost works out to Rs. 180.04 Lakh/MW.
The Commission would like to clarify that the escalation on account of additional taxes is being provided purely on normative basis after balancing various factors affecting the market conditions as discussed above and shall be applicable irrespective of the actual channel of procurement of the Solar PV modules. In fact, in case of procurement from indigenous sources the BCD/SGD will not be applicable at all. The Commission feels that this approach will not only enable the developers to procure the modules in the most economical manner but may also encourage procurement from indigenous sources.
Further, the Commission decides to retain the CUF specified under the draft regulations as the same is lower than the CUF specified by the neighbouring States and Central Commission. Further, it is pertinent to mention that the CUF of 19% was fixed considering Poly Silicon Solar Module and Thin Film Solar Module. However, in the present Order, the Commission has considered Mono PERC Solar Module which is an advance technology in comparison to Thin film Solar Module and results into higher CUF which in turn reflects higher generation from the said modules. Moreover, the Commission has considered the spot prices which are generally on a higher side, and the developers will have the benefit of economies of scale on bulk purchase as well as enjoy bulk purchase discount. Furthermore, the Commission in the current regulations has retained additional 300 points for interest on normative loan above the average SBI MCLR (one year) prevailing for last available six months in accordance with the provisions specified by CERC which has been reduced to 200 basis points vide RE Regulations, 2020 by CERC. Moreover, the Commission has approved annual O&M expenses on a very higher side in comparison to other States. Accordingly, the solar power developers in the State will gain additional interest benefit of 1% as the Commission has kept the interest rate based on 300 basis points and increased the O&M expenses which may offset the increase under one head by decrease under the other head.
Further, with regard to Land cost, some of the stakeholder submitted that due to increase in circle rates, the land cost will increase. In the matter, it is pertinent to mention that under most of the schemes the projects are proposed to be installed in barren lands of hilly terrain. Further, stakeholders have not submitted any supporting documents to support their claim. The Commission has considered 5 acres of land for Solar PV plant having capacity of 1 MW. However, as discussed earlier, with the change in technology lesser area is required for installation of Solar PV plants. Accordingly, saving in the land cost can be utilized to make the land suitable for installation of Solar PV plant. Moreover, as per Solar Policy, 2023 the detailed guidelines for lease rent determination will be notified by UREDA on their website from time to time in consultation with Uttarakhand Solar Power Land Allotment Committee. Accordingly, the Commission may review the land cost while determining the capital cost for solar energy based projects in ensuing year based on the information of lease rent available with UREDA.
The Commission had earlier approved the cost for other components for FY 2022-23 of Rs. 108.96 Lakh/MW escalating by 20% to factor in the hike in prices and change in technology then. Now for FY 2023-24, the Commission has escalated the said amount based on the average of CPI and WPI of last three years giving equal weightage. Accordingly, the Capital cost for Solar PV plants works out to Rs. 345.11 Lakh/MW.
Further, with regard to capital cost of Canal Bank Solar PV Plants and Canal Top Solar PV plants, on one hand UJVN Ltd is proposing a higher capital cost and on the other, the tariff bidded by its developers in the range of Rs. 4.18 per unit to Rs. 4.26 per unit. Hence, there seems no reason to specify higher capital cost for the same. Further, the land is already owned by it and any increase in other cost components can be offset by the land costs which is a saving to it. Hence, the Capital Cost for Canal Bank Solar PV plant has been specified as Rs. 400 Lakh/MW and Capital cost for Canal Top Solar PV Plant as Rs. 425 Lakh/MW

1.31.5 The Stakeholders requested the Commission to reduce the banking charges stating that the same are too high and banking may be allowed annual basis. In the matter, it is pertinent to mention that the Forum of Regulators issued “Model Regulation on Methodology for calculation of Open Access charges and Banking charges for Green Energy Open Access Consumers” wherein FOR has specified the banking charges and the permitted banking period. Model Regulations specifies that the Banking Charges shall be adjusted in kind @ 8% of the energy banked and banking of energy shall be permitted only on monthly basis as per Calendar month. Accordingly, the Commission decides to reduce the banking charges to 8% whereas the request of the stakeholders for permitting the annual adjustment of banking is rejected keeping in view the Model Regulations issued by FOR.

1.32.7 With regard to multiple evacuation networks to the generator, it is pertinent to mention that the UPCL specifies the connectivity point/Sub-Station, to which the generating plant is to be connected after detailed study of load flow, voltage profile, Sub-station capacity and other technical parameters etc, at the time of execution of PPA with the generator. Besides it is the duty of the distribution licensee to evacuate power and provide connectivity. Further, it is to be noted that deemed generation cannot be disallowed on the basis of connectivity of the plant to independent feeder or mixed feeder. It would be appropriate for distribution licensee to strengthen its distribution network including evacuation system so that the power generated from such plant can be supplied which would in return help the distribution licensee to meet its RPO and also the demand in the State. Accordingly, the Commission does not find it prudent to change the provision of the said regulation in this regard. However, the Commission directs UPCL to strengthen the evacuation systems of that particular area where such plants are connected or proposed to be connected.
Further, force majeure conditions are already excluded from the limit of 48 hours in a month for Small Hydro Plants and such events already are defined in the Regulations. UPCL's comments regarding exclusion of synchronisation time taken by the generator for synchronising the machines on the grid does not find merit as due to outages the generator's machines were forced to stop and no generator would want to delay the synchronization just to claim deemed generation. However, the same can be examined on case to case basis and if in any case it is observed that the generator took exceptionally long time to synchronise the machines the delay may not be allowed.
With respect to UPCL's comments regarding the generation window of 12 hours in a day in case of Solar plants in comparison to 24 hours for SHPs, the duration of outage on proportionate and equitable basis considering same analogy comes out to be 24 hours in a month in place of 50 hours in a year, the Commission accepts the same partially and allows exclusion of 12 hours in a month as force majeure for calculation of deemed generation. Further, the distribution licensee is required to maintain and augment its infrastructure so as to ensure that generation is not lost. Any loss of generation unless due to force majeure conditions would be on account of inefficiency
of the licensee and the same cannot be in any manner allowed to be pass through in tariffs.
